I have played Destiny 2 constantly because of lockdown this past year and before that on and off since D2 release. I love this game so much and want it to do well, sometimes love Bungie themselves, but I have no idea what was going through their brains with removing this much from the game.

Positives:

- Story missions take longer to finish which if you are a new player is great, but I have seen for me or other veterans, they were still quick in someways.
- The new class is a lot of fun (When I first tried it out was the best) but I do miss my Void Vanish as a Hunter Main :p
- The new planet is beautiful and fun to explore
- The whole story was a great concept and I loved the whole plot. (Even if it felt like a copy of the Forsaken plot).
- The new engine has made the graphics feel new and fresh, colours seem bright and full. I love that part the most.

Negatives:

- Bungo went way to far this time with Sunsetting. Seasonal gear should NOT be sunset, some of my favourite weapons are now mostly useless and took away some of my enjoyment of the game.
- The DLC's story was good but it didn't FEEL like a DLC campaign. I didn't have enough meat to it, not enough to get your teeth into. I was going through I expecting something crazy to happen but that never really happened for me :/
- I bought the £60 version of the DLC and I feel massive regret because it's not even worth the standard price. The money I have spent on this game this year coming to now feels like a waste with how much Bungo has disappointed me.
- I recently had a friend of mine get into D2 this month. What they have done to free-to-play is utter ♥♥♥♥♥♥♥. You get no campaigns and playing the FTP campaign you get at the start of playing is mostly grind. If you want to play Crucible or Gambit you are just gonna get rekt because Statis has made Crucible a mess right now. What they have done to FTP is evil in my opinion. I played Forsaken with him and he didn't get to feel any connection to the story because all of the old stories were removed. It was pretty much, "who even is Cayde-6" for him.
- Vaulting a bunch of gear is like a big punch in the face for me. Working for hours and hours through interesting quests and difficult quests for it to now just be put into a store that you repetitively grind for. I understand you want to save space but games are getting bigger now, its just the way it is. One of the biggest PVP games out there right now is nearly 260GB and Bungie is scared of D2 going over 100GB. I PAID FOR THAT DLC GEAR & CONTENT!!!
- The season pass seems very easy to ignore this time.
- The devs don't seem to be active with the community as much as they used to anymore, I know with the pandemic it's hard to be, but with how much was counting on this DLC being good. I feel listening to us would have helped you a lot.
- As I said before, Crucible is a big mess with new gear and stasis being OP.
- Gambit has been stripped down and even it's director is sad to look at.
- This may just be me, but new quests now seem more grindy than before to try and drag out content. Grinding was never something I liked but in Destiny, I was okay with it because other reasons helped make it more enjoyable.
- My favourite RAIDS were removed and you can just "one-phase" the new raid boss anyway which doesn't make it that enjoyable.

I should have listened to myself when I said "No Pre-orders". It seems past-me let me down because I totally regret getting it now and the season pass. If the DLC goes on sale for a decent price, I say get it but for £30+ it isn't worth it. What have you done Bungie.
